About the Program

The MOT Testing (Classes 4 and 7) Level 2 Award is a non-degree program for students who want to become MOT testers. It is taught in English and takes one year to complete. The main advantage of this program is that it helps students develop the skills needed to test vehicles safely and efficiently.

The curriculum covers topics such as vehicle inspection, testing procedures, and safety protocols. Students will also learn how to use specialized equipment to test vehicles. The program includes hands-on components to help students gain practical experience in testing vehicles.

Graduates of this program can work as MOT Testers, Vehicle Inspectors, or Workshop Technicians. They can find jobs in the automotive industry, working for companies that operate MOT test centers or vehicle repair workshops. Other potential job titles include Service Technicians or Quality Inspectors.
